Subject: New foto's of the Wagon Mon 12 Mar - 21:39
Heres some fotos I took today of the Wagon's new look
Roof bars removed and the roof repainted and new trims to go on(barless look ,also hd the rear arches done and the scoop n vents painted so they now match the bonnet, also Just Dents from darlo's been out today and all the car park dinks removed (brilliant job and very cheap) I've a pair of morettes with cold air feeds (inner lamps removed) to go in thats just been painted aswell
rear craddle's now fitted with poly bushes
Toucan touch screen display with gauges and cal switch
next upgrade 2.35CDB which is builtup just waiting for supertech valves to be delivered for big port Jdm AVCS heads and gt35-82
